Resource: Perangkat
Resource perangkat mewakili instance perangkat yang dikelola perusahaan di properti.
Representasi JSON |
---|
{
"name": string,
"type": string,
"traits": {
object
},
"parentRelations": [
{
object ( |
Kolom | |
---|---|
name |
Wajib. Nama resource perangkat. Misalnya: "enterprises/XYZ/devices/123". |
type |
Hanya output. Jenis perangkat untuk tujuan tampilan umum. Misalnya: "THERMOSTAT". Jenis perangkat tidak boleh digunakan untuk menyimpulkan atau menyimpulkan fungsi perangkat sebenarnya yang ditetapkan. Sebagai gantinya, gunakan trait yang ditampilkan untuk perangkat. |
traits |
Hanya output. Trait perangkat. |
parentRelations[] |
Detail perangkat milik penerima perangkat. |
ParentRelation
Menunjukkan hubungan perangkat, misalnya, struktur/ruangan tempat perangkat ditetapkan.
Representasi JSON |
---|
{ "parent": string, "displayName": string } |
Kolom | |
---|---|
parent |
Hanya output. Nama relasi -- misalnya, struktur/ruangan tempat perangkat ditetapkan. Misalnya: "enterprises/XYZ/structures/ABC" atau "enterprises/XYZ/structures/ABC/rooms/123" |
displayName |
Hanya output. Nama kustom relasi -- misalnya, struktur/ruangan tempat perangkat ditetapkan. |
Metode |
|
---|---|
|
Menjalankan perintah ke perangkat yang dikelola oleh perusahaan. |
|
Mendapatkan perangkat yang dikelola oleh perusahaan. |
|
Mencantumkan perangkat yang dikelola oleh perusahaan. |